以太坊钱包区块同步(以太坊钱包加速同步方法:重写区块链数据不需下载)

以太坊钱包区块同步

以太坊是一种开放源代码的去中心化平台,它允许开发者通过智能合约构建分布式应用程序。作为以太坊用户,使用以太坊钱包进行交易是一种常见的操作。但是,有时候在使用以太坊钱包时会发现区块同步非常慢,甚至会导致交易失败。本文将介绍如何加速以太坊钱包的区块同步。

为什么区块同步会很慢?

以太坊的区块链是一个非常大的数据集,它包含了所有的交易记录和智能合约代码。当你使用以太坊钱包时,钱包需要从网络中的其他节点下载区块链数据,并在本地建立一个完整的区块链数据库。这个过程需要消耗大量的带宽和计算资源,而且随着区块链的不断增长,同步时间将更长。

此外,网络拥塞也可能导致区块同步速度变慢。当有很多人同时访问网络时,网络负载会变得非常高,从而影响节点间的数据传输。这可能会导致请求数据时出现延迟或超时,从而导致区块同步变得非常慢。

如何加速区块同步?

有几种方法可以加速以太坊钱包的区块同步:

1. 使用高性能的服务器

如果你的计算机配置不够高端,可能会导致区块同步变得非常慢。使用高性能的服务器可以大大加快同步速度,因为服务器通常拥有比较快的网络连接和更好的计算资源。

你可以在云服务器上部署以太坊节点,然后将以太坊钱包连接到这个节点来加速同步。这个方法需要相应的成本支出,但可以获得很好的性能提升。

2. 使用以太坊钱包的快速同步选项

以太坊钱包有一个快速同步选项,可以大大加快区块同步速度。此选项会忽略之前的交易记录,只下载最近的几个区块,然后从网络同步最新的交易记录。这样可以有效地减少区块同步耗时。

要启用快速同步选项,请在启动以太坊钱包时添加“–fast”参数。例如:

$ geth --fast

快速同步选项会在本地建立一个新的区块链数据库,因此启动时间可能会更长一些。

3. 重写区块链数据

如果上述方法都不起作用,或者你不想使用高性能的服务器或者快速同步选项,你还可以尝试重写区块链数据。这个方法可以不必重新下载区块链数据,而且可以大大缩短同步时间。

重写区块链数据的方法是将本地的区块链数据清空,然后从网络重新下载最新的数据。这样可以解决本地数据损坏或不完整的问题。

要重写区块链数据,请按照以下步骤进行:

关闭以太坊钱包并等待它完全退出。

找到以太坊钱包数据文件夹。该文件夹的位置取决于不同的操作系统。你可以在以太坊钱包主页中找到该文件夹的位置。

删除该文件夹下的“geth”文件夹。

重新启动以太坊钱包。

现在,你的以太坊钱包将会从网络重新下载最新的区块链数据,并建立一个新的区块链数据库。这个方法可以大大加快区块同步速度,但在同步过程中可能会消耗更多的带宽和计算资源。

总结

以太坊钱包区块同步是使用以太坊钱包时的一个重要问题。如果你发现区块同步速度非常慢,可以尝试使用高性能的服务器、启用快速同步选项或者重写区块链数据。以上这些方法都可以大大加快区块同步速度,使你更顺畅地使用以太坊钱包。

原创文章,作者:区块链,如若转载,请注明出处:https://www.53moban.com/21657.html

联系我们

400-800-8888

在线咨询:点击这里给我发消息

邮件:admin@example.com

工作时间:周一至周五,9:30-18:30,节假日休息